Suburban Poultry Egg Laying Competition
DescriptionSimple roll-and-move game designed to show early 20th century everyday life in outer suburban Australia. The game has 365 spaces where players traverse across semi rural land dotted with Victorian era housing and chicken coops. Published by the National Games Company which is credited to have been the first large-scale Australian manufacturer of locally-designed board games. Recorded in the National Archives of Australia, where copyright registration and exhibit is dated 1915.
